使用从 X 中的行到矩阵 Y 中的行的指针恢复矩阵 X,而无需在 MATLAB 中执行循环



在 MATLAB 中,假设我知道我的 N 行矩阵的每一行如何X对应于矩阵Y中的行。具体来说,假设X为 1000 x 3,Y为 40 x 3,v为 1000 x 1,X(i,:) = Y(v(i,1),:)表示X行。有没有有效的方法可以使用Yv恢复X而不会进行超过 1:1000 的循环?

索引可以是向量:

X = Y(v,:);

最新更新